The read-modify-write is not atomic, but only current modifies the count and every interrupting user is balanced, so nothing is lost. ftrace_caller itself, including the early CALL_OPS direct path and the late direct tail that carry a BPF trampoline address in x17 with the count at zero, is static kernel text: add an ftrace_static_tramp_end marker after ftrace_stub_direct_tramp and provide arch_rcu_tasks_ip_in_trampoline() covering [ftrace_caller, ftrace_static_tramp_end) so the irq-exit check treats a task interrupted anywhere in it as inside a trampoline. The hook is built only under CONFIG_RCU_TASKS_PREEMPT_QS, which arm64 does not select until a later patch.
